    I am so excited. Thanks Doc for encouraging me! Well if read my other post you know I got a CA to delete. Yesterday was 30th day for my first round of TU disputes so I used a credit denial to get a free report on line. I disputed 3 accounts and all 3 are gone!

    One was an alleged bad check (I really believe I did not write this check). I paid the collection before I knew any better. I sent the CA a validation letter and disputed with CRA's about 2 weeks later. It's been deleted.

    Another was a paid telephone bill. I sent the notarized nutcase letter (Thanks Doc!) and disputed with CRA's 2 weeks later. It worked!

    The third deletion was stubborn. I sent validation letter and disputed 2 weeks later. They supposedly validated early before the 30th day of the dispute. I had just enough time to get the estoppel to the CA before the 30 days ended. They sent me a letter saying they are deleting and what do you know, it's gone!

    Now how many points gained, a measley 30!

    But I am so excited, I am finally making progress!

    None of these are my Experian but all are on my Equifax. My disputes are do soon and I'm hoping for equal success!
